加密货币的安全性及原因解析

加密货币的安全性来源于哪些方面?

加密货币之所以拥有较高的安全性主要得益于以下几个方面:

1. 加密技术: 加密货币使用了先进的密码学技术,如非对称加密、哈希函数和数字签名等,确保了交易的秘密性和完整性。

2. 匿名性: 加密货币交易可以使用虚拟钱包地址进行,不需要提供个人身份信息,使得交易参与者可以保持匿名。

3. 防篡改: 加密货币使用了分布式账本技术(区块链),使得交易记录无法被篡改,保证了交易的可信度和透明性。

4. 分布式网络: 加密货币的交易数据存储在分布式网络中,如果一台服务器被攻击或故障,网络中其他节点仍然可以继续运行,确保了系统的鲁棒性。

加密货币的加密技术如何保障安全性?

加密货币的安全性主要依赖于以下几种加密技术:

1. 非对称加密: 加密货币使用了非对称加密算法,采用公钥和私钥的组合来加密和解密数据。用户可以使用自己的私钥对交易进行签名,其他人使用对应的公钥可以验证签名的有效性,从而确保交易的真实性。

2. 哈希函数: 加密货币使用哈希函数将交易数据转化为固定长度的哈希值,确保交易的完整性。即使交易数据发生微小的变化,生成的哈希值也会发生巨大的改变,从而可以检测到数据被篡改。

3. 数字签名: 加密货币的交易需要使用私钥进行数字签名。数字签名将交易和私钥绑定在一起,验证者可以使用相应的公钥来验证数字签名的有效性,确保交易的真实性和完整性。

为什么加密货币的匿名性能提供更高的安全性?

加密货币的匿名性能为用户提供了更高的安全性,原因如下:

1. 隐私保护: 传统的金融交易通常需要提供个人身份信息,而加密货币使用虚拟钱包地址进行交易,无需提供个人身份信息,保护用户的隐私。

2. 防止身份盗用: 加密货币的匿名性使得攻击者难以追踪和窃取用户的身份信息,降低了身份盗用的风险。

3. 自由交易: 匿名性使得用户可以自由地进行交易,无需担心个人信息被滥用或泄漏,提高了交易的便利性和自由性。

加密货币的分布式账本如何保证交易的安全性?

加密货币的分布式账本(区块链)是保证交易安全性的重要因素,主要有以下特点:

1. 共识机制: 区块链通过共识机制来验证和确认交易,确保交易记录的一致性。常见的共识机制包括工作量证明(PoW)和权益证明(PoS)。

2. 分布式验证: 区块链中的每个节点都拥有完整的交易记录副本,通过网络中的节点相互验证交易,确保交易的有效性和一致性。这种分布式验证方式减少了单点故障和篡改的可能性。

3. 不可篡改性: 区块链上的每个区块都包含前一个区块的哈希值,形成了链式结构,保证了交易记录的不可篡改性。如果有人试图更改某个区块的数据,将会导致后续区块的哈希值发生变化,从而被其他节点拒绝。

加密货币的安全性存在哪些潜在风险?

在加密货币的安全性方面,仍然存在一些潜在的风险和挑战:

1. 私钥安全: 加密货币的安全性依赖于用户的私钥,如果私钥被泄露、丢失或被盗,将导致资产的丧失。因此,用户需要妥善保管私钥,避免遭受安全威胁。

2. 交易所风险: 用户在交易所进行加密货币交易时,可能面临交易所被黑客攻击、内部操作不当或平台破产等风险。选择安全可靠的交易所进行交易至关重要。

3. 技术漏洞: 加密货币系统可能存在未被发现的安全漏洞,攻击者可以利用这些漏洞进行攻击和盗取资产。开发者需要持续关注和修复系统中的漏洞。

加密货币的安全性是否绝对?有没有可能被攻破?

虽然加密货币的安全性较高,但并不意味着它是绝对安全的,也存在被攻破的可能性:

1. 量子计算机: 量子计算机拥有强大的计算能力,可能对当前使用的加密算法造成威胁。一旦量子计算机问世,现有的加密货币系统可能需要升级或采用抗量子攻击的算法。

2. 社会工程学攻击: 攻击者可能通过社会工程学手段获取用户的私钥或个人信息,从而攻破加密货币的安全性。用户需要提高警惕,不轻易泄露个人信息和私钥。

3. 集中化风险: 尽管加密货币使用了分布式账本技术,但部分加密货币项目或交易所可能存在集中化风险。一旦攻破了这些集中化的节点,可能对整个系统造成影响。

总结:加密货币的安全性主要来自于先进的加密技术、匿名性、防篡改的分布式账本和分布式网络等因素。加密货币的安全性并非绝对,仍存在私钥安全、交易所风险、技术漏洞、量子计算机等问题,用户需要保持警惕并选择安全可靠的交易平台进行操作。